Abstract
The catalysts of nanometer TiO2/BuOH and hydrous TiO2 were prepared by the liquid-phase method from Ti(SO4)(2). The properties of the catalysts were c haracterized by TG-DTA, IR, XRD, TEM methods. The results showed that nanom eter TiO2/BuOH was anatase particles with 10 nm X 20 nm. The main product i n styrene epoxidation with t-butyl hydroperoxide(TBPH) was styrene epoxide, by-product was phenylformaldehyde under the condition of 80 degreesC for 6 h. Hydrous TiO2 prepared below 260 degreesC was non-crystal powder and con verted into anatase particles with 10 nm X 300 nm when it was roasted at 50 0 degreesC. The catalytic activity of 10 nm X 300 nm anatase particles had only 50% that of particles with 10 nm X 20 nm. The centers of acid on the c atalyst surface made the epoxide selectivity decrease obviously. The order of the influence of solvent on epoxidation reaction: 1, 2-dichloroethane > butanol > cyclohexanone > methyl-cyclohexane > cyclohexanol > acetic acid.
